Landmark Atrium proudly unveils a new Art LANDMARK experience, created in collaboration between globally renowned artist Rokkaku Ayako and GALLERY TARGET. This interactive art installation, 'THE ISLAND - ONIGASHIMA', marks the largest-scale work of the artist to date. From now until April 17th, the atrium of Landmark Atrium will transform into a vibrant and sensory art experience, inviting visitors to immerse themselves in this captivating and mysterious artistic island.
Landmark has always been committed to bringing world-class art experiences to Central. This time, we are excited to present Rokkaku Ayako's first solo exhibition in Hong Kong, featuring the largest-scale installation art piece ever displayed in a commercial space, 'THE ISLAND - ONIGASHIMA'. Internationally acclaimed for her dynamic finger-painted works, Rokkaku Ayako depicts a vibrant and whimsical fantastical world that has captivated audiences across Asia, solidifying her status as one of the most sought-after figures in contemporary art.
Exploring 'THE ISLAND – ONIGASHIMA': An Immersive Dreamlike Island
The artwork draws inspiration from the Japanese folk tale 'ONIGASHIMA'. When Rokkaku Ayako decided to hold her exhibition in Hong Kong, she was inspired by the shared island geography of the two places. She incorporated the imaginative 'ONIGASHIMA' from the Japanese folktale 'Momotaro'. Additionally, the legendary image of Momotaro as 'half-human, half-demon' in the story cleverly symbolizes the boundary between dreams and reality. This fantastical element inspired Rokkaku Ayako to blend playfulness and mystery in her installation, blurring the line between the artist and the audience.
The artwork is meticulously crafted with soft forms and a variety of textured fabrics, inviting not only visual appreciation but also physical interaction from the public. Standing at a towering height of six meters, the installation majestically unfolds in the atrium, creating a museum-like interactive zone. Visitors are encouraged to touch, feel, and even lean on the artwork, crafting their own artistic journey based on their preferences. One can imagine themselves stepping into a gigantic, vibrant soft sculpture and sensing its textured pulse through touch, fully immersing themselves in this enchanting and mysterious dreamlike island. Inside the art installation, a unique pathway is designed to display 12 wooden sculptures for visitors to view up close, along with 11 paintings hidden within the installation. These carefully selected precious works are not for sale, solely presented to offer visitors a layered artistic discovery experience.

A self-taught artist, Rokkaku Ayako first came to prominence in 2006. Her works blend comic elements with abstract emotional hues, and she creates without sketches, improvising as she goes to directly express her artistic emotions. Known for her signature 'big-eyed girls' and vibrant dreamlike backgrounds, she has earned high praise from art collectors worldwide. She has also received the Grand Prize at the 'GEISAI' art festival hosted by the contemporary art master Murakami Takashi. Exclusive Interactive Experiences and Collectibles Extend the Artistic Journey
In addition to the atrium exhibition, a pop-up store at BELOWGROUND offers visitors a chance to delve deeper into Rokkaku Ayako's artistic universe. The store features 9 original works, multiple exclusive limited-edition artworks, including 50 limited-edition prints and 3 limited-edition bronze sculptures, as well as a range of exclusive merchandise. Visitors can purchase limited-edition tote bags, apparel, books, scarves, and collaborative limited-edition lamps with AllRightsReserved, bringing home a piece of 'THE ISLAND – ONIGASHIMA' and forging a closer connection with Rokkaku Ayako's artistic realm.
